Best Gardening Jokes:

  • I wasn’t particularly interested in gardening, but I planted a few seeds… And it grew on me.
  • Why couldn’t the budding gardener grow anything? They hadn’t botany plants.
  • What’s a gardener’s favorite Beatles song? “Lettuce Be.”
  • What did the gardener say when someone asked how they found the time for their garden? “It’s next to the sage.”
  • What’s small, red, and whispers? A hoarse radish.
  • Why doesn’t Elton John like lettuce? He’s more of a Rocket Man.
  • What’s a gardener’s favorite type of trousers? Ones with turnips.
  • Sherlock Holmes was doing some gardening. Watson asked what he was planting. He replied, “A lemon tree, my dear Watson.”
  • What runs around a garden but never moves? A fence.
  • One gardener to another: “Spring is almost here!” The other gardener: “I’m so excited I could wet my plants!”
  • Why didn’t the woman accept the job as a gardener? Because the celery was too low.
  • What is The Hulk such a good gardener? He’s got green fingers.
  • What is a gardener’s favorite Harrison Ford film? Raiders of the Lost Bark.
  • Why did the gardener make lots of money clearing leaves? He was really raking it in.
  • What do you call a cheerleading herb? An encourage mint!
  • How did the millionaire gardener get rich so quickly? He was running a huge pansy scheme.
  • What do you call a garden that is chicken-proof? Impeccable.
  • Knock, knock! Who’s there? Lettuce. Lettuce who? Lettuce in, it’s cold out here.
  • Did you hear about the gardener who went crazy? He was hearing voices in his shed.
  • What do you get if you cross a four-leaf clover with poison ivy? A rash of good luck.
